[7] The modern town was Started in 1869 by Midhat Pasha, the Ottoman Wali (Governor) of Baghdad. The Ottomans sought to control the Beforehand nomadic Dulaim tribe while in the region as part of a programme of settling the Bedouin tribes of Iraq from the utilization of land grants, within the perception that This might bind them much more intently for the state and make them much easier to University of AlMaarif control.[six][8]

On January 3, 2016, the Iraqi Govt declared that it experienced recaptured eighty% of Ramadi city, and that the sole pockets of ISIL resistance in the town right remaining were located in the al-Malab and 20th Street regions.[seventy nine] On January four, 2016, a British Formal mentioned that the volume of ISIL militants remaining in Ramadi were reduced to about 400 fighters.[15] RAF Tornado GR4s offered near air assist to your Iraqi Military because they ongoing their operations to remove the remaining terrorist fighters in and all-around Ramadi. When an Iraqi device came underneath rocket-propelled grenade and mortar fire from many ISIL-held properties, the GR4s performed accurate strikes on all 4 buildings working with Paveway IVs.
